Self-Care Wellness Hub: YOU@UWM 

YOU@UWM is your one-stop hub for self-care tips, guidance and campus resources to support your academics, well-being and social life. Check in with yourself, set goals and access UWM services anytime. Create a confidential account with your ePantherID.

On-Campus Mindfulness Spots and Resources 

Need help with focus, stress, or sleep? Mindfulness can help. Visit the website for campus mindfulness spaces, events and resources. The mindful Space at SHAW offers a peaceful spot to relax with a massage chair, VR goggles and happy lamps. Reserve your 30-minute session today.

Peer-to-Peer Connections: Togetherall 

Togetherall is an online platform where students connect virtually with peers on campus and across the country facing similar mental health challenges. Sign up with your UWM email.

Brief Conversations with a Counselor: Let’s Talk

Feeling stressed or dealing with personal issues? Let’s Talk offers a quick, informal virtual chat with SHAW counselor. Schedule your session on our website!

Alcohol and Other Drug Support: BASICS

If substance use is affecting your life, BASICS offers a confidential space to reflect and explore options for change. Learn more and schedule an appointment on the BASICS website.

Counseling Services

SHAW Counseling Services offers in-person and virtual therapy for individuals, couples, and groups, plus psychiatry and case management. Visit the website or call 414-229-7429 option 2 to schedule an appointment.

Virtual Therapy: Mantra Health

Mantra Health offers free teletherapy with evening and weekend appointments, plus identity-specific counselors. For more info or to schedule, visit the website and log in with your UWM email.

24/7 Support and Crisis

If you or a loved one is facing a mental health crisis or in need of immediate support, call UW Mental Health Support 24/7 at 888-531-2142.
